#2f7410 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f7410 is composed of 18.4% red, 45.5%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.2%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 101.4 degrees, a saturation of 75.8% and a lightness of 25.9%. #2f7410 color hex could be obtained by blending #5ee820 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#2f7410 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f7410 has RGB values of R:47, G:116,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 3109904.
